What are the responsibilities and job description for the FuSa & Quality Manager - Automotive SoC position at Vivid Technology?

Fresh off a successful funding round, this cutting-edge startup (Series B) is building chip-scale, solid-state THz vision technology that delivers exceptional imaging performance and paves the way for new possibilities in mobility, defense, and beyond.


They are looking for an experienced and driven Functional Safety Manager with a strong background in Quality Management to lead safety-critical activities in our automotive semiconductor development programs. This role is crucial in ensuring their chip designs meet the stringent functional safety and quality requirements of the automotive industry, including the ISO 26262 and IATF 16949 standards.


The successful candidate will collaborate with cross-functional engineering teams to drive functional safety compliance from concept through production, while also leading initiatives to uphold and enhance our quality management systems.



RESPONSIBILITIES


Functional Safety (ISO 26262 – Automotive Specific):

  • Lead the implementation and management of functional safety activities for automotive chip (SoC/ASIC) programs.
  • Develop, maintain, and review safety concepts, safety plans, and technical safety requirements.
  • Conduct or supervise safety analyses (FMEA, FMEDA, DFA, FTA) throughout the development lifecycle.
  • Own the creation and maintenance of safety work products, including safety case documentation and safety manuals.
  • Interface with OEMs, Tier-1 customers, and assessors to communicate safety goals, progress, and compliance.
  • Support ASIL decomposition, SEooC strategy, and hardware-software interface definitions in line with ISO 26262.


Quality Management (IATF 16949 / Automotive SPICE):

  • Implement and improve quality systems to ensure compliance with IATF 16949 and ISO 9001 requirements.
  • Lead internal and supplier audits focused on both functional safety and product quality.
  • Collaborate with design, verification, and validation teams to embed quality into the automotive chip development process.
  • Drive continuous improvement, non-conformance resolution, and CAPA processes for safety-related issues.
  • Ensure effective traceability and documentation across the safety lifecycle, supporting ASPICE alignment where applicable.



SKILLS & EXPERIENCE


  • Degree in Electrical Engineering, Computer Engineering, or a related technical field.
  • 8 years of experience in semiconductor or SoC design, with at least 3 years in a functional safety leadership role in the automotive domain.
  • Deep knowledge of ISO 26262, especially Part 5 (hardware) and Part 11 (SEooC).
  • Practical experience in automotive-grade chip development (analog/digital/mixed-signal).
  • Hands-on experience with safety and quality tools such as Medini Analyze, FMEDA software, and requirements management tools (e.g., DOORS, Polarion).
  • Proven experience implementing or maintaining quality management systems based on IATF 16949 and ISO 9001.
  • Strong communication and stakeholder management skills, especially with customers and certification bodies.



ADVANTAGEOUS


  • TÜV or equivalent Functional Safety Certification.
  • Experience with ASPICE and integration of safety processes into ASPICE frameworks.
  • Knowledge of automotive cybersecurity standards (ISO/SAE 21434) is a plus.
  • Familiarity with OEM-specific safety and quality requirements (e.g., from VW, BMW, Toyota, etc.).
